CFRP (Carbon Fiber Reinforced Plastic) parts
Due to the properties of the carbon fiber used in CFRP parts, the shade
and density of the carbon fiber weave may vary.

WARNING
After adjusting the angle of the rear wing
Make sure that the bolts and nuts are tightened securely. If they are not, the
rear wing may come off while driving, possibly leading to an accident.
CAUTION
Handling of the rear wing
Do not push or pull the rear wing with excessive force. Doing so may dam-
age the rear wing.
When waxing the vehicle, be careful not to leave any residual wax
between the wing and wing end-plates.
When adjusting the angle of the rear wing
Observe the following precautions. Otherwise, the rear wing may be dam-
aged.
Make sure to loosen the rear nuts and bolts before adjusting the angle of
the rear wing.
When installing the rear bolts, make sure that both the left and right bolts
are installed to the same position for the desired angle.
Do not loosen the nuts and bolts on the front side.
